Php ile Geliştirilmiş Ajax Takvim Uygulaması
Ornegimizde de inceleyecegimiz takvim uygulamasi asp.net' te surukle birak islemiyle
cok bir kisa surede yapilabiliyor fakat phpdeki gibi her satirina sizin yon
verdiginiz bir uygulama yazma imkani tanimiyor bu sebep nedeniyle. Hersey standart,
kaliplasmis sizin takvime mudahele edip kendinizce birseyler eklemeniz oldukca guc.
Phpde yazdigimiz bu takvim uygulamasinda ekleyeceginiz iki satir kod ile ajandanizi
olusturabilirsiniz mesela.
Bunun yaninda bu belirttiklerimin sadece benim goruslerim oldugunu Asp.net' inde
kendine gore ustun yonlerinin oldugunu belirtmek isterim. php, asp.net, jsp, cfm vs.
bunlar arasindaki secimi yapmak tamamen uygulama gelistiriciye ve tabi ki kosullara
bagli.
Simdi uygulama icinde gecen mktime fonksiyonunun islevine kisaca deginelim:
mktime : Bu fonksiyon date fonksiyonuyla birlikte kullanilarak ilerideki tarihlerde
yada gecmis tarihlerdeki degerlere ulasma imkani tanir.
Genel Kullanimi:
//bu sekilde bir kullanimla belirtilen ileri
veya gecmis tarihle ilgili ayin kac gun cektigini dondurur.
date("t",mktime(0,0,0,month,day,year))
seklindedir.
mktime () fonksiyonunun islevini uygulama icerisinde daha iyi gorecegiz.
İlerleyen gunlerde bu yonde talep olmasi durumunda bu uygulamayi genisletici daha
komplike ornekler verebiliriz.
Program Kodlari : (Renklendirilmis)
http://www.turk-php.com/ornekler/takvim_...=index.php
http://www.turk-php.com/ornekler/takvim_...=style.css
Programin Calisan Hali:
http://www.turk-php.com/ornekler/takvim_.../index.php
Tum Dosyalar:
http://www.turk-php.com/ornekler/takvim_...lamasi.zip
Not:
Turkce karekterlerin duzgun cikmasi icin etiketinden once asagidaki iki satiri index.php
dosyasi icinde ekleyiniz: